The “5 stars” items could actually have a few lower ratings hidden in there. These are hidden on the item page so that a single bad user cannot bring down an items rating.
So I guess it doesn’t base the profile rating off the average of the final item star rating, but the average of all the votes across items. In which case the lower votes that are hidden on the individual pages actually combine together to reflect an overall item rating.
